repo.or.cz
/
dragonfly.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
kqueue: Hint is not used by socket filters
2015-12-20
Sepherosa Ziehau
k
q
u
e
ue:
H
i
nt is not
u
s
e
d
by socket
f
ilter
s
commit
|
commitdiff
|
tree
2015-12-20
Sephero
s
a
Ziehau
kqueue: Remove
u
nappli
e
d comment
commit
|
commitdiff
|
tree
2015-12-20
S
e
pherosa Ziehau
kqueue
:
Minor style
c
h
a
nge
s
commit
|
commitdiff
|
tree
2015-12-20
Sepherosa Zieh
a
u
kqueue:
Avoid duplicate KN_PROCESSING cleari
n
g
commit
|
commitdiff
|
tree
2015-12-20
Sepher
o
sa Ziehau
kqu
e
ue: knote
_
allo
c
will never fai
l
commit
|
commitdiff
|
tree
2015-12-20
S
e
p
h
erosa Ziehau
kq
u
eue: F
i
x
description for ker
n
.
kq_che
c
kloop
commit
|
commitdiff
|
tree
2015-12-14
Sep
h
erosa Ziehau
inet/mcast: Don't
fr
e
e inp_moptions in ip_se
t
mo
p
tions()
commit
|
commitdiff
|
tree
2015-12-11
Sepherosa
Z
iehau
if: Bandaid ifa_if
w
ithnet() for
i
faddrs w/ same netmas
k
commit
|
commitdiff
|
tree
2015-12-09
Sepherosa Ziehau
inpc
b
: Spli
t
por
t
info token i
n
to t
o
ken
s
for porthash
.
.
.
commit
|
commitdiff
|
tree
2015-12-07
S
e
p
hero
s
a Ziehau
igb: Fix DMACR settings
commit
|
commitdiff
|
tree
2015-12-07
S
ephe
r
osa Ziehau
inpcb: Push
porthash toke
n
down a bit and
u
s
e
atomi
c
.
.
.
commit
|
commitdiff
|
tree
2015-12-04
Sepherosa Ziehau
a
t
om
i
c: F
i
x
atomic_
c
mpset_long prototype
commit
|
commitdiff
|
tree
2015-12-04
S
eph
e
rosa Ziehau
atomic: Add atomi
c
_cmpset_
s
hort
commit
|
commitdiff
|
tree
2015-12-04
S
epherosa Ziehau
socket:
so_
r
e
f 0->
1
t
ransition
i
s valid for an aborted
.
.
.
commit
|
commitdiff
|
tree
2015-12-03
Sepherosa Ziehau
ix: U
p
date t
o
Intel
ix-2
.
8
.
2
commit
|
commitdiff
|
tree
2015-12-03
Sepher
o
sa Ziehau
ifmedia: Add two
helpe
r
functio
n
s for ifmedi
a
_add and
.
.
.
commit
|
commitdiff
|
tree
2015-11-30
Sephero
s
a Zieh
a
u
kevent: Re
d
uce kqu
e
ue
t
oke
n
contention
commit
|
commitdiff
|
tree
2015-11-30
Sephe
r
osa Ziehau
kevent:
Fix comment and remove ext
r
a b
l
ank lin
e
commit
|
commitdiff
|
tree
2015-11-30
Sephe
r
o
s
a Ziehau
h
ammer: A
l
ways
s
e
t noa
t
ime f
o
r hammerf
s
commit
|
commitdiff
|
tree
2015-11-28
S
e
phero
s
a Z
i
ehau
kevent:
Mark file
_
filtops and kqread_
f
iltop
s
MPSA
F
E
commit
|
commitdiff
|
tree
2015-11-28
Sepherosa Ziehau
kevent: Fix comment
commit
|
commitdiff
|
tree
2015-11-27
Sephe
r
osa
Z
iehau
soc
k
et: Make sur
e
that accept queues are e
m
pty bef
o
re
.
.
.
commit
|
commitdiff
|
tree
2015-11-27
Sepherosa
Z
i
eha
u
s
oc
k
et: Make sur
e
so_refs wil
l
not go from 0 t
o
1
commit
|
commitdiff
|
tree
2015-11-27
Sephero
s
a Zie
h
au
soc
k
e
t: Remov
e
fo_ioctl(FIONBIO) for socke
t
s
.
commit
|
commitdiff
|
tree
2015-11-27
Seph
e
rosa Ziehau
em/emx
/
igb: Prop
e
rly set
status fo
r
m
a
nually con
f
ig
u
red
.
.
.
commit
|
commitdiff
|
tree
2015-11-27
Sepherosa Ziehau
mxge:
Always
s
e
nd
t
he c
u
rrent media (optics) bac
k
to
.
.
.
commit
|
commitdiff
|
tree
2015-11-26
Sepherosa
Ziehau
mxge:
Integrate
ifmedia flow contro
l
support
.
commit
|
commitdiff
|
tree
2015-11-26
Sephero
s
a Ziehau
m
x
ge: Fix ifmedia relat
e
d
bits
commit
|
commitdiff
|
tree
2015-11-26
Sepherosa
Z
i
e
hau
ix: I
n
tegrate ifmedia fl
o
w control support
.
commit
|
commitdiff
|
tree
2015-11-26
S
e
p
h
ero
s
a Z
i
ehau
em
.
4/igb
.
4: S
e
t
dat
e
properly
commit
|
commitdiff
|
tree
2015-11-26
S
epherosa
Z
ieh
a
u
i
x
.
4
:
i
xX ->
ixY and dev
.
i
x
.
X -> dev
.
ix
.
Y
commit
|
commitdiff
|
tree
2015-11-25
Se
p
he
r
osa Z
i
ehau
i
x: Set u
p
ifm_a
c
tive pro
p
erly when link is not u
p
.
commit
|
commitdiff
|
tree
2015-11-25
Sepherosa
Z
iehau
ifmedia: Reset ifm_media
a
n
d
ifm_cu
r
in
ifmed
i
a_re
m
o
v
eall()
commit
|
commitdiff
|
tree
2015-11-25
Sep
h
erosa Ziehau
ix:
F
ix optics and ifmed
i
a setti
n
gs
commit
|
commitdiff
|
tree
2015-11-25
Sepheros
a
Ziehau
i
gb: Fix ifmedia leakag
e
on detach path
.
commit
|
commitdiff
|
tree
2015-11-25
Sepheros
a
Z
ie
h
au
ig:
F
acto
r
out
e1000
_
forc
e
_
f
lowctr
l
commit
|
commitdiff
|
tree
2015-11-25
S
e
pheros
a
Ziehau
em/emx: In
t
egr
a
t
e
ifmedia flow control supp
o
rt
.
commit
|
commitdiff
|
tree
2015-11-25
S
e
ph
e
ros
a
Zieha
u
i
g
b: Integrat
e
ifmedia
flow control support
.
commit
|
commitdiff
|
tree
2015-11-24
Sepherosa Ziehau
ifmed
i
a: Macro nam
i
ng
a
nd add fu
n
ction to co
n
vert
str
.
.
.
commit
|
commitdiff
|
tree
2015-11-24
Sephe
r
osa Z
i
ehau
ifmedia/ifc
o
nfig: Tak
e
flowc
o
ntrol as
an alias for
.
.
.
commit
|
commitdiff
|
tree
2015-11-24
Sepherosa Ziehau
ifme
d
ia: Initial
i
ze ifm-
>
ifm
_
media to IFM
_
NONE
commit
|
commitdiff
|
tree
2015-11-24
S
e
p
herosa
Z
iehau
if
m
edia:
Fix SI
O
C
G
IFMEDIA
i
fmr_current va
l
ue
commit
|
commitdiff
|
tree
2015-11-24
Sephero
s
a Zi
e
h
au
ifmedia: Set ifm-
>
i
f
m_
m
edia p
r
o
p
e
r
ly upon
ifmedia_set()
commit
|
commitdiff
|
tree
2015-11-24
Sepherosa Zi
e
h
a
u
ifmedia: Add IFM_ETH_MAN
U
FL
O
W
.
commit
|
commitdiff
|
tree
2015-11-23
Sepherosa
Z
iehau
ifmedia: Define flow control r
e
lated descriptio
n
pr
o
per
l
y
commit
|
commitdiff
|
tree
2015-11-20
Sep
h
e
r
osa Zie
h
au
ig: F
a
ctor out f
u
nc
t
i
o
ns
for flow
c
on
t
r
ol
commit
|
commitdiff
|
tree
2015-11-20
Sephe
r
o
s
a
Z
iehau
igb: Supp
o
rt f
l
ow
co
n
trol
c
hange a
n
d default to
R
X
.
.
.
commit
|
commitdiff
|
tree
2015-11-20
Sepherosa Ziehau
em:
S
upport flow control change and
d
efault to
RX pause
commit
|
commitdiff
|
tree
2015-11-20
Seph
e
rosa Ziehau
emx: Add per-device flow
c
ontrol tunable supp
o
rt
commit
|
commitdiff
|
tree
2015-11-20
Seph
e
rosa Zie
h
au
devi
c
e: Add device_
g
etenv_s
t
rin
g
()
commit
|
commitdiff
|
tree
2015-11-20
Sephero
s
a
Ziehau
d
evice: Pref
e
r de
v
.
driver
.
unit
.
k
n
o
b
f
or
p
er-device
.
.
.
commit
|
commitdiff
|
tree
2015-11-20
Sephero
s
a
Ziehau
emx
:
Support flo
w
control chang
e
an
d
defau
l
t
to R
X
.
.
.
commit
|
commitdiff
|
tree
2015-11-20
S
epherosa Ziehau
kern
/
lwp: Check lwp_loc
k
before
remove lwp from process
.
.
.
commit
|
commitdiff
|
tree
2015-11-19
S
epherosa Z
i
eh
a
u
pthre
a
d: Add l
w
p_setname(2
)
a
n
d i
m
plement p
t
hrea
d
_se
t
_
n
ame_np
(
3)
commit
|
commitdiff
|
tree
2015-11-19
S
epher
o
sa Ziehau
kinfo/
p
roc: Set nthreads pro
p
erly fo
r
kernel threads
commit
|
commitdiff
|
tree
2015-11-19
Sep
h
e
r
o
s
a
Z
i
e
h
au
top: Fi
x
h
eader name an
d
width
f
or process r
u
nning
.
.
.
commit
|
commitdiff
|
tree
2015-11-18
Sephe
r
osa Ziehau
kern: Hold lwp before p
o
ssible
b
l
ocking
operation
commit
|
commitdiff
|
tree
2015-11-18
Sepherosa Ziehau
top:
P
u
t
ke
r
nel idle t
h
reads, i
.
e
.
id
l
e_X to t
h
e end
.
.
.
commit
|
commitdiff
|
tree
2015-11-18
Sepherosa Ziehau
t
o
p: Fix up processes cpu usage perce
n
tage us
i
ng u
t
icks
.
.
.
commit
|
commitdiff
|
tree
2015-11-17
Sepher
o
sa Zie
h
au
kinfo: Set kernel idle
t
h
r
ea
d
s st
a
te t
o
S
I
D
L
.
commit
|
commitdiff
|
tree
2015-11-17
Sephe
r
os
a
Ziehau
udp: Wakeup caller
s
slee
p
ing
o
n failed to connect so
c
ket
.
commit
|
commitdiff
|
tree
2015-11-17
Sepherosa
Ziehau
sound/
d
sp: Fix no
n
blockin
g
suppor
t
.
commit
|
commitdiff
|
tree
2015-11-17
Sepher
o
s
a
Ziehau
bus
:
Fix
d
evctl nonblocking support
.
commit
|
commitdiff
|
tree
2015-11-16
Sepher
o
sa
Ziehau
kinfo: Ze
r
o-out pctcpu for zombie processes
commit
|
commitdiff
|
tree
2015-11-16
Sep
h
erosa Zi
e
hau
top: Use k
p
_ktad
d
r
as
k
e
r
n
e
l thr
e
ad 'id
'
commit
|
commitdiff
|
tree
2015-11-16
Sepherosa Ziehau
kinfo:
D
e
liv
e
r
a
ddress o
f
kernel thr
e
a
d
commit
|
commitdiff
|
tree
2015-11-15
Seph
e
rosa Zi
e
hau
inpcb:
Unbreak SO_REUSEPORT
supp
o
rt
.
commit
|
commitdiff
|
tree
2015-11-15
Sephero
s
a Ziehau
udp: Fix bind races due t
o
asyn
c
close and r
a
ndom so
c
ket
.
.
.
commit
|
commitdiff
|
tree
2015-11-15
Sepherosa
Z
iehau
tcp:
F
ix
b
ind r
a
ces due to async close and ran
d
om socket
.
.
.
commit
|
commitdiff
|
tree
2015-11-14
Sephero
s
a Zi
e
h
au
top:
F
ix
system process cpu usage percentage disp
l
ay
commit
|
commitdiff
|
tree
2015-11-14
Sepherosa Zieha
u
top: Fix
'
c'
for
-S and -
I
commit
|
commitdiff
|
tree
2015-11-14
Sephero
s
a Zie
h
au
style: Fix whit
e
spac
e
s
commit
|
commitdiff
|
tree
2015-11-14
Sepherosa Ziehau
uipc
:
P
o
r
t Unix socket domain GC from FreeBSD
.
commit
|
commitdiff
|
tree
2015-11-12
Sepherosa Ziehau
uipc:
R
elease token in
the pro
p
er orde
r
on uncon
n
e
c
ted
.
.
.
commit
|
commitdiff
|
tree
2015-11-09
Sepherosa Zi
e
h
au
uipc
:
Use taskqueue to run GC
.
commit
|
commitdiff
|
tree
2015-11-09
Sepherosa Ziehau
uipc: No need to call sorflush() before unp_gc()
commit
|
commitdiff
|
tree
2015-11-09
Sepher
o
s
a
Z
iehau
test: Add t
e
st for u
n
ix soc
k
et cross/se
l
f reference
commit
|
commitdiff
|
tree
2015-11-06
Sepherosa Zi
e
hau
uipc:
U
se
token for rig
h
ts counting
commit
|
commitdiff
|
tree
2015-11-06
Seph
e
r
osa Ziehau
uipc: Factor out
unp_{add,del}_right()
commit
|
commitdiff
|
tree
2015-11-05
Sepherosa Z
i
eh
a
u
uipc: Consolidate unp_drop()
commit
|
commitdiff
|
tree
2015-11-04
Sepherosa Ziehau
uipc: Use fd
r
o
p
i
nstead of closef
commit
|
commitdiff
|
tree
2015-11-04
Sepherosa Zi
e
h
au
revoke
.
2:
U
pdat
e
manp
a
ge for ea8f3
2
4
c
34cc7837fa0cc397d
3
29322
.
.
.
commit
|
commitdiff
|
tree
2015-11-04
Sephe
r
o
sa Ziehau
uipc: Use CTASSERT
t
o sim
p
l
i
f
y
the
externali
z
e/inte
r
n
a
lize
.
.
.
commit
|
commitdiff
|
tree
2015-11-04
Sephero
s
a
Zi
e
hau
uipc: Remove unne
c
essary unp_t
o
ken in unp_dispose(
)
commit
|
commitdiff
|
tree
2015-11-04
Seph
e
ros
a
Ziehau
socket: Dis
p
ose
r
ig
h
ts
d
irectly in
s
o
r
ec
e
ive(), if
.
.
.
commit
|
commitdiff
|
tree
2015-11-03
S
e
pherosa Zie
h
au
uipc: Reduce token
coverage on
d
e
tach
path
commit
|
commitdiff
|
tree
2015-11-03
Sep
h
erosa Ziehau
u
ipc: Remove unne
c
essar
y
s
o
cket ref/u
n
ref on detach
.
.
.
commit
|
commitdiff
|
tree
2015-11-03
Sepherosa Ziehau
uipc: Hold unp_tok
e
n before calling unp_find_lockre
f
()
commit
|
commitdiff
|
tree
2015-11-03
Sephe
r
osa Zieh
a
u
gdb:
U
nbre
a
k buildi
n
g
commit
|
commitdiff
|
tree
2015-11-02
zrj
s
ocke
t
/recvfrom: Add MSG_CMSG_CLOEXEC suppor
t
commit
|
commitdiff
|
tree
2015-10-30
Sepherosa Zie
h
au
bpf: A
d
d support for 802
.
11 pac
k
e
t
injection via bpf
commit
|
commitdiff
|
tree
2015-10-30
S
e
pher
o
sa
Z
i
e
hau
t
o
ols/kq_conn
e
ct_
c
lient: Use SOCK_NO
N
BLO
C
K if it'
s
.
.
.
commit
|
commitdiff
|
tree
2015-10-30
Sepherosa Zieha
u
s
ocket: Add
a
ccept4 s
y
scall a
n
d bu
m
p __DragonFly_
v
ersio
n
commit
|
commitdiff
|
tree
2015-10-30
Sepherosa Ziehau
socket: Sh
o
rtcircuit FIONBIO in so
o
_ioctl(
)
.
commit
|
commitdiff
|
tree
2015-10-30
Se
p
herosa Ziehau
socket/
s
ocketpair: Add SOCK_{NO
N
BLOCK,CLOEXEC} suppor
t
.
commit
|
commitdiff
|
tree
2015-10-30
Sepherosa Ziehau
tools/kq_connect_cli
e
nt: Add op
t
ion to bin
d
proc
e
s
s
.
.
.
commit
|
commitdiff
|
tree
2015-10-30
Sepherosa Ziehau
tcp: Use
4-
t
uple
hash to
optim
i
ze local p
o
rt selection
.
commit
|
commitdiff
|
tree
2015-10-29
Sepherosa
Zie
h
au
systat/pv:
L
og
t
o
t
a
l IPI, externa
l
interrupts and
MP
.
.
.
commit
|
commitdiff
|
tree
2015-10-29
Seph
e
rosa Zieha
u
ipd
e
mux: B
e
tte
r
i
nitial so_por
t
distribution for non
.
.
.
commit
|
commitdiff
|
tree
2015-10-29
Sepherosa Ziehau
udp: Implement
asyn
c
hronized p
r
u_connect
.
commit
|
commitdiff
|
tree
next